Which sentence contains an essential adjective clause?

English
1 answer:
natta225 [31]3 years ago
4 0
An essential clause does not require commas. Having this in mind, there is only one sentence here that is not separated by commas, so the correct answer is A. The coach explained the rules that the officials revised in 2010.
